There is that, but there's also the safety factor. Changing the URL in libnickel is completely unsupported and risks bricking the device. Most threads (hopefully all, but I haven't read them all) talking about how to edit or patch Kobo-provided firmware files carries a suitable warning. The Kobo Utilities plugin, so far anyway, only does operations which we can all be reasonably certain (based on the long use of the KoboTouch driver) are quite safe. It still isn't supported, but nothing in the Kobo Utilities plugin is going to brick your device if it's done a tiny bit wrong.
